Factors Affecting Cost
Expanding a bathroom in Pittsburgh, PA, involves various factors that can influence overall project costs and scope. Understanding typical considerations can help in planning and comparing options for bathroom enlargement projects in the area.
- Materials: Choices range from standard drywall and ceramic tiles to premium fixtures and custom cabinetry, impacting overall expenses.
- Size and Scope: The extent of enlargement-such as adding space into adjacent rooms or expanding existing footprints-affects project complexity and cost.
- Labor Complexity: Structural modifications, plumbing rerouting, and electrical adjustments can influence labor requirements and duration.
- Permitting: Local regulations in Pittsburgh may require permits for structural changes, plumbing, or electrical work, affecting timelines and costs.
- Extras: Additional features like new lighting, ventilation systems, heated floors, or custom finishes can add to the overall project scope and expense.
